Output 42c95ca985f920d1bff5c327f88d62312d5964dcf94cfaab4519312ae08cda44:17

value
23967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ae812d7c63fc5b8f11567fc83fa1127566fc62c OP_EQUAL
address
32gghDeMMKGpqhu1uaHG74J38oeKp31Ch4
transaction
42c95ca985f920d1bff5c327f88d62312d5964dcf94cfaab4519312ae08cda44